1. Seed PlantingSelect suitable ornamental lotus seeds, rub the concave end of the seeds on the cement floor, soak the seeds in warm water and wait for seedlings. During the germination process, the water should be changed frequently to keep the water clear. The buds will sprout in about a week. When the roots grow to about 10cm, they can be transplanted. Plant one plant in each pot. The water layer should be shallow, about 3-5cm. The lotus leaves should not be submerged in water. 2. Planting lotus roots1. Choose March or April for planting. Before planting, mix the potting mud into a paste. 2. When planting, insert the lotus root head into the soil at an angle of 20 degrees along the edge of the pot. Keep the head low and the tail high, with half of the tail lifted up, and do not let the lotus root tail enter water. 3. After planting, place it under the sun until the surface of the soil is slightly dry and cracks appear. When the lotus root is completely bonded to the soil, add a small amount of water. After the buds grow out, gradually deepen the water level and keep it at 3-5cm. |
